イミュータブル(IMX)が注目される技術的強みとは?



イミュータブル(IMX)が注目される技術的強みとは?


イミュータブル(IMX)が注目される技術的強みとは?

近年、ブロックチェーン技術の進化に伴い、様々な分散型台帳技術が登場しています。その中でも、イミュータブル(Immutable X、以下IMX)は、NFT(Non-Fungible Token)の取引に特化したレイヤー2ソリューションとして、急速に注目を集めています。本稿では、IMXが持つ技術的な強みについて、詳細に解説します。

1. IMXの概要:NFTのスケーラビリティ問題への挑戦

NFTは、デジタル資産の所有権を明確化し、新たな経済圏を創出する可能性を秘めています。しかし、イーサリアム(Ethereum)などの主要なブロックチェーン上でNFTを取引する場合、スケーラビリティの問題が深刻化します。具体的には、取引手数料の高騰や処理速度の遅延などが挙げられます。これらの問題は、NFTの普及を阻害する要因となり得ます。

IMXは、これらの問題を解決するために開発されたレイヤー2ソリューションです。レイヤー2ソリューションとは、メインのブロックチェーン(レイヤー1)の負荷を軽減し、取引の処理速度を向上させる技術です。IMXは、ZK-rollupと呼ばれる技術を採用しており、オフチェーンで取引を処理することで、イーサリアムの負荷を大幅に軽減します。

2. ZK-rollup技術の優位性

ZK-rollupは、Zero-Knowledge Proof(ゼロ知識証明)と呼ばれる暗号技術を利用しています。ゼロ知識証明とは、ある情報を持っていることを、その情報を明らかにすることなく証明できる技術です。IMXでは、このゼロ知識証明を利用して、オフチェーンで処理された取引の正当性を、イーサリアム上で検証します。

ZK-rollupの主な優位性は以下の通りです。

  • 高いスケーラビリティ: オフチェーンで取引を処理するため、イーサリアムの負荷を軽減し、取引処理速度を向上させます。
  • 低い取引手数料: イーサリアムのメインチェーンでの取引回数を減らすことで、取引手数料を大幅に削減します。
  • 高いセキュリティ: ゼロ知識証明によって、取引の正当性を保証するため、セキュリティを確保します。
  • プライバシー保護: ゼロ知識証明は、取引内容を明らかにすることなく正当性を証明できるため、プライバシー保護にも貢献します。

3. IMXのアーキテクチャ:主要コンポーネント

IMXは、以下の主要なコンポーネントで構成されています。

3.1. イーサリアムコントラクト

IMXの基盤となるスマートコントラクト群です。NFTのデポジット、ウィズドロー、取引などを管理します。これらのコントラクトは、イーサリアム上で動作し、IMXのエコシステム全体の整合性を維持します。

3.2. オフチェーンエンジン

NFTの取引をオフチェーンで処理するエンジンです。ZK-rollup技術を利用して、取引の正当性を検証し、バッチ処理を行います。これにより、取引手数料を削減し、処理速度を向上させます。

3.3. プロバー

オフチェーンエンジンで処理された取引の正当性を、イーサリアム上で検証する役割を担います。ゼロ知識証明を生成し、イーサリアムコントラクトに提出します。

3.4. データ可用性レイヤー

オフチェーンで処理された取引データを安全に保管する役割を担います。データの可用性を確保することで、IMXのエコシステムの信頼性を高めます。

4. IMXの技術的特徴:詳細な解説

4.1. ガスレス取引

IMXの最も重要な特徴の一つが、ガスレス取引です。通常、イーサリアム上でNFTを取引する場合、ガス代(取引手数料)を支払う必要があります。しかし、IMXでは、ユーザーはガス代を支払うことなくNFTを取引できます。これは、IMXがガス代を負担することで実現されています。ガスレス取引は、NFTの取引コストを大幅に削減し、より多くのユーザーがNFTに参加できるようになります。

4.2. 高速な取引処理

IMXは、ZK-rollup技術を採用しているため、非常に高速な取引処理が可能です。イーサリアム上でNFTを取引する場合、取引の承認には数分から数時間かかる場合があります。しかし、IMXでは、取引はほぼ瞬時に完了します。高速な取引処理は、NFTの取引体験を向上させ、より多くのユーザーを引き付ける要因となります。

4.3. 豊富な開発ツール

IMXは、開発者がNFTアプリケーションを簡単に開発できるように、豊富な開発ツールを提供しています。これらのツールには、SDK(Software Development Kit)、API(Application Programming Interface)、ドキュメントなどが含まれます。開発者は、これらのツールを利用することで、IMX上で動作するNFTアプリケーションを迅速に開発できます。

4.4. NFTのメタデータ管理

IMXは、NFTのメタデータを効率的に管理するための機能を提供しています。メタデータとは、NFTに関する情報(名前、説明、画像URLなど)のことです。IMXは、分散型ストレージを利用して、NFTのメタデータを安全に保管します。これにより、NFTのメタデータの改ざんを防ぎ、NFTの信頼性を高めます。

4.5. 互換性

IMXは、ERC-721やERC-1155などの一般的なNFT規格と互換性があります。これにより、既存のNFTプロジェクトは、IMXに簡単に移行できます。また、IMXは、様々なウォレットやマーケットプレイスと連携できます。これにより、ユーザーは、IMX上でNFTをシームレスに取引できます。

5. IMXの活用事例

IMXは、様々な分野で活用されています。以下に、いくつかの活用事例を紹介します。

  • ゲーム: IMXは、ゲーム内のアイテムやキャラクターをNFTとして発行し、プレイヤーが自由に取引できるようにします。これにより、ゲームの経済圏を活性化し、プレイヤーのエンゲージメントを高めます。
  • デジタルアート: IMXは、デジタルアート作品をNFTとして発行し、アーティストが作品を販売できるようにします。これにより、アーティストは、新たな収益源を確保し、ファンとの関係を深めることができます。
  • コレクティブル: IMXは、トレーディングカードや限定版アイテムなどのコレクティブルをNFTとして発行し、コレクターが自由に取引できるようにします。これにより、コレクティブルの価値を高め、新たな市場を創出します。
  • チケット: IMXは、イベントのチケットをNFTとして発行し、不正なチケット転売を防ぎます。これにより、イベント主催者は、収益を最大化し、イベントの安全性を確保できます。

6. IMXの今後の展望

IMXは、NFTのスケーラビリティ問題を解決し、NFTの普及を促進する可能性を秘めています。今後は、さらなる技術開発を進め、より多くのNFTプロジェクトやユーザーをIMXのエコシステムに引き込むことが期待されます。具体的には、以下の点が今後の展望として挙げられます。

  • ZK-rollup技術のさらなる最適化: ZK-rollup技術の効率性を向上させ、取引処理速度をさらに高速化します。
  • 新たな開発ツールの提供: 開発者がより簡単にNFTアプリケーションを開発できるように、新たな開発ツールを提供します。
  • パートナーシップの拡大: さらなるNFTプロジェクトや企業とのパートナーシップを拡大し、IMXのエコシステムを拡大します。
  • DeFiとの統合: IMXとDeFi(Decentralized Finance)を統合し、NFTを活用した新たな金融サービスを創出します。

まとめ

IMXは、ZK-rollup技術を採用したNFTに特化したレイヤー2ソリューションであり、高いスケーラビリティ、低い取引手数料、高いセキュリティなどの技術的強みを持っています。ガスレス取引や高速な取引処理などの特徴は、NFTの取引体験を向上させ、より多くのユーザーがNFTに参加できるようになります。IMXは、ゲーム、デジタルアート、コレクティブル、チケットなど、様々な分野で活用されており、NFTの普及を促進する可能性を秘めています。今後の技術開発とエコシステムの拡大により、IMXはNFT市場において、ますます重要な役割を果たすことが期待されます。


前の記事

ベーシックアテンショントークン(BAT)が市場で急騰した理由を分析!

次の記事

ビットフライヤーを使った仮想通貨の始め方完全マニュアル

コメントを書く

Leave a Comment

メールアドレスが公開されることはありません。 が付いている欄は必須項目です